On Sunday, March 10th at South By Southwest in Austin, TX, Jordan and I will do a LIVE DEMO of Shadowrun Returns and take questions from the audience. Also in attendance will be our Guest of Honor, Erik Dahlman, one of our $10,000 Backers (and resident of Austin).
SXSW is another great opportunity to get some press for the game and help get the word out. But don’t worry, you won’t need to attend the show to see the game in action! We’re releasing a VIDEO WALKTHROUGH of Shadowrun Returns gameplay, narrated by Jordan and me, the Friday before the show. We’ll release our first set of REAL SCREENSHOTS, too.
And don’t forget, we’ll be at Seattle’s Emerald City Comic Con tomorrow, March 2, talking about the game, answering questions, and doing the dwarf dance as little as possible. We’ll be in the Gaming Room at 12pm. Hope you can join us!

I have a question to the gameplay vid on youtube: Are there no ‘interruptions’ in the fighting mode?? In the vid your just walking through, running around corners killing everybody. If you would do so in a real tactical turnbased shooter like JA2 you’d be interrupted by the waiting guards. Same for the real Shadowrun pen&paper: I was gamemaster long time and no runner would have dared blindly storming around corners in a room full of enemies cause he’d get killed. Interruptions are what gives turn-based fighting games tactical depth no matter if on screen or paper. Otherwise its just running around killing.
